I am building a Space Marine army, and I wanted to have my commander armed with a thunder hammer because I love the looks of it compared to the power fists (the list is not competitive) but I haven't been able to find a way to get a Hammer to give him. Did GW ever mould these hammers for anyone but terminators?

I just got in a bits order some left arm power armor thunder hammers. They're in the bits catalog under 'iron hands' accessories

With a little bit of Green Stuff, you can convert a Warhammer, "hammer" by adding some power feeds. That opens up a LOT of different options.

Use the Standard bearer's arm from the command squad, then clip it down and place a Chaos warrior hammer on the end and BAM! Thunderhamer. Did it at gamesday when they released the SM Codex. Looks sweet too.
